Imposter syndrome can be a challenging experience for individuals to overcome, but it does not necessarily mean that they are on the wrong path.

The fear of failure is a common aspect of imposter syndrome, but it is important to remember that making mistakes is a natural part of the learning process.

Instead of focusing on negative thoughts and self-doubt, individuals should try to remind themselves of their achievements and strengths, seek support from encouraging individuals in their community, and continue to pursue their goals.

With continued effort and determination, individuals can overcome imposter syndrome and build the life they want. ⏩⏩
